Cost of Rainwater Management in Lynchburg

Zip

Managing rainwater in Lynchburg, VA, is essential to prevent flooding, erosion, and water contamination. The cost of rainwater management can vary significantly based on several factors, including the size of the property, the complexity of the system, and the specific needs of the area. Understanding these factors and the common tasks involved can help property owners budget effectively for rainwater management solutions.

Factors Affecting Cost

  • Property Size: Larger properties typically require more extensive systems, increasing the overall cost.
  • System Complexity: More complex systems with advanced features like filtration and storage will cost more.
  • Material Quality: Higher-quality materials ensure durability but come at a higher price.
  • Labor Costs: Skilled labor in Lynchburg may vary in price, impacting the total cost.
  • Permitting Fees: Local regulations may require permits, adding to the cost.
  • Maintenance Requirements: Systems needing regular maintenance will incur ongoing costs.
  • Topography: Hilly or uneven terrain can complicate installation and increase costs.

Average Costs for Common Tasks

Task Average Cost (Lynchburg, VA)
Installing Rain Barrels $150 - $300
Building a Rain Garden $1,000 - $3,000
Installing a French Drain $2,000 - $6,000
Gutter Installation $4 - $10 per linear foot
Downspout Extensions $50 - $150 per downspout
Permeable Pavement Installation $10 - $20 per square foot
Regular System Maintenance $100 - $300 annually
